4、层级顺序:z 功能:类似于CSS里的z-index属性,默认值为0; 详解:当不设置这个值的时候(或者两个元素的属性z值都相同时),默认是,后面一个在前面一个的上面(子元素在父元素的上面),所以我们可以通过改变z属性值来设置两个元素的层次,一般来讲,值越大,越处于上层。 十年编程老舅:十年程序员 对于 Qt开发 学习...
可以将CSS注入到QML WebView中。QML WebView是一种用于在QML应用程序中显示Web内容的组件,它基于Qt WebEngine。要将CSS注入到QML WebView中,可以使用QWebEngineProfile和QWebEngineScript类来实现。 首先,需要创建一个QWebEngineProfile对象,并使用QWebEngineProfile::defaultProfile()函数获取默认的Web引擎配置文件。然...
*个人在简单体验了一下QML开发之后,感觉QML是一个很类似前端CSS的技术,把页面变成一个单独的模块,也算是一种完美贯彻MVC模式的工具吧(毕竟之前还是会有很多人把业务放到界面里面去写,而且也会被人疯狂乱喷)某种意义上来说,*这也是一种真正在Qt上进行前后端分离的方案,这倒是挺新颖的。* 另外值得一提的点,QML...
在Qt QML中,可以使用Qt Quick Controls提供的一些预定义组件,如Button、TextField等。但是,如果想要自定义组件的外观和样式,可以使用CSS来实现。 要将CSS组件添加到Qt QML中,可以按照以下步骤进行: 创建一个QML文件,例如"CustomButton.qml"。 在QML文件中定义一个自定义组件,例如一个按钮。
51CTO博客已为您找到关于qml如何使用css的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及qml如何使用css问答内容。更多qml如何使用css相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
一、qml简介 qml是一种描述性的脚本语言,语法类似css, 可以在脚本中创建图像对象,并支持各种特效,并且文件是以.qml结尾。qml文档描述 了一个对象树。各个元素可以以嵌套的方式来组合成复杂的图形功能。qml是Qt quick的核心组件之一。qml是运行时解释,不需要重新编译。二、第一个例子 使用Qt Creator来创建空的...
QML是Qt提供的一种描述性的脚本语言,类似于CSS(Cascading Style Sheets),可以在脚本里创建图形对象,并且支持各种图形特效,以及状态机等,同时又能跟Qt写的C++代码进行方便的交互,使用起来非常方便。采用QML加插件的方式主要是为了将界面设计与程序逻辑解耦,一般的系统开发中界面设计的变动往往多于后台逻辑,因此采用QML加...
这个属性类似于css里面的z-index属性,默认值是0,当不设置这个值的时候,或者两个元素的属性z值都相同时,默认是,后面一个在前面一个的上面,子元素在父元素的上面,所以我们可以通过改变z属性值来设置两个元素的层次,一般来讲,值越大,越处于上层。这里分为两种情况: ...
二、QML语法格式非常像CSS,但又支持JavaScript形式的编程控制,在QML中,通过具有属性的对象树来表示用户...